HD 600

This classic pair of open-back headphones from Sennheiser is one of the best headphones in its price range. They have good sound quality, comfort and re-usable components. They have a large soundstage that accurately portrays the vocals and instruments, but can be a bit lacking in bass for certain. Some listeners might find their slightly bright tone annoying.

The HD 600 is an extremely robust and comfortable, lightweight headphone. Its design is made up of metal, plastic, and velour. The headband is foam-padded and secures itself to the ears. The earcups are large which means they are able to fit larger heads. Its cable is detachable, and it can be replaced with a larger version if required.

HD 650

The HD 650 is an open-back headphones that is designed for audiophiles. They have a neutral response, allowing the listener to be able to hear the full range of the music without being overpowered by bass or other frequencies. Mixing engineers will find them to be a ideal choice for those who want to hear every detail in their mixes, without being fatigued by headphones that place a lot of emphasis on certain frequencies. The HD 650 also have above-average consistency in the bass range, meaning they will sound similar no matter how you position or wear them. They are less uniform in the treble and you may hear a 6dB difference depending on your ear shape and the way you wear them.

The HD 650s are comfortable to wear during long sessions because the headband and earpads are made from a soft comfortable and comfortable material. The headband is cushioned to prevent it from putting too much pressure on your ears. The large elliptical cups can will comfortably fit any ear size. The earpads have plenty of room for air to circulate, headphones Gaming helping keep your ears from becoming hot during long listening sessions. The headphone weighs 269 grams without cable, so it is light enough to wear for long periods of time.
